Not long after her recent bout in the arena, Otome sat hunched over the counter of one of Kumogakure's shadier bars, a jug filled to the brim with sake in her right hand. It was the second such bottle she had downed since entering the establishment a few minutes ago, and yet she doubt it would be her last as her recent loss against the Konoha gaijin haunted her thoughts. She closed her eyes and sighed before dispelling her doubt with a swig of the potent brew.
"Aren't you a little young to be in here?" one of the bartenders--a well-built man nearing the end of his middle-age years--teased her, prompting a nasty glare from her. "Not that I mind that is; business is business, after all."
The kunoichi remained silent, opting to take another swig of sake instead of divulging her trepidation to this stranger. However a familiar, annoying laugh behind her caused her grip to tighten around the jug's handle.
"Oh, you don't need to tell the Butcher of Kumogakure that!" another woman chimed in.
"Butcher of Kumogakure?" the bartender backed away and motioned to the bouncers at the door as Otome growled.
"Why, you haven't heard?" the same woman continued mocking Otome's rampage of justice. "The woman before you has killed no less than fifty innocent people as she indulges in delusions of self-righteousness."
Had she been in better spirits, Otome would have simply enjoyed some bitter banter between both women as was usual for her.
However, she wasn't in the mood and as such chucked the bottle of sake at her accuser before storming out of bar.
"I'm not the one who's guilty, Sadako," she thought to herself as she marched with no particular destination in mind. "And once everyone knows just how guilty you are, I will personally execute you myself!"
